Synchronizing on the Zipato Controller
There are a total of 3 sync points you need to be aware of. One sync does not do it all.
During install and programming, you will be using all 3. After that, typically syncs would only be needed on the app(s).
When using the Web Interface:
You have a sync point on the LEFT for whenever you add, remove, or configure a device (any changes on the left side)
You have a sync point on the RIGHT any rules you add, remove, or revise a rule (any changes on the right side)
A good habit would be to sync on both sides whenever using the web interface.
On the App:
Note: The hardware of the Zipatile and the Zipato app running on it do not automatically sync. So, after any changes done elsewhere (web or remote app), you will need to sync the Zipato app on the Zipatile as well.
The app (on the Zipatile or the phone) has a Sync point in the MENU. This syncs the app to the "box" ( hardware of the tablet/box). This would be used whenever a change is made either from the web or from an app running on another device.
The user will use this sync to update the settings and readings on the app.
